Since the sartorius muscle is very long and crosses two joints (the hip and the knee) it serves many functions for your body and lower extremities. At the hip it flexes, weakly abducts, and rotates the thigh laterally. The sartorius muscle crosses both the hip and knee joints, producing movements on both of them.
